If you're interested in 3D ultrasound pictures, start by asking at your provider's office. That said, you may have a personal reason for wanting to have a 3D image or 4D video made. Some private clinics encourage moms-to-be to return for multiple sessions, which means even more exposure for their babies. Part of the problem is that 3D ultrasounds and 4D ultrasounds take longer than 2D ultrasounds, so your baby is exposed to a lot more sound waves. Experts don't know enough about the effects to say that unneeded ultrasounds are totally risk-free. Waves in the megahertz range have enough energy to heat up tissues slightly, and possibly produce tiny bubbles inside the body. Though there's no proven risk, healthcare providers advise against getting 3D ultrasounds that aren't medically necessary or 4D ultrasounds. There's no guarantee that staff at these clinics are trained properly – or that the ultrasound operator will be qualified to help you if you have questions, or if your ultrasound reveals a problem. If you go to a private clinic offering 3D and 4D ultrasound (like those in malls), you're going to a business that likely operates more like a portrait studio than a medical office. In a doctor's office, you can be confident of your care team's skills. Part of the reason is that all medical devices should be operated by trained, licensed professionals. The Food and Drug Administration, which regulates medical devices, strongly discourages 3D and 4D ultrasounds for keepsake images and videos. Can I get a 3D ultrasound at a private clinic near me? If your provider recommends this, your 3D ultrasound will be done along with other ultrasounds in a medical office and covered by insurance. These can include cleft palate or other visible physical problems. 3D ultrasound can be useful to diagnose or monitor conditions that are harder to spot on a regular ultrasound. That's why most healthcare providers don't use 3D ultrasound regularly. ![]() For most pregnancies, 3D ultrasound won't give any more usable information than a standard 2D image. These early scans are used to date a pregnancy and due date, and check on suspected problems such as ectopic pregnancy.įind out more about ultrasounds during pregnancy. If your provider needs to do an ultrasound in the first trimester, she may use a vaginal probe to get closer to your uterus. Many women will have an earlier 2D ultrasound as well. When you're done, the technician will probably give you a few black-and-white images as a keepsake. You'll be able to hear the heartbeat and if your baby is awake, you'll see movement on the screen. These waves bounce off your baby, and a computer translates the echoing sounds into video images that reveal details of your baby's body, position, and movements. During your ultrasound, a technician will use a handheld instrument called a transducer to send sound waves through your uterus. You'll probably have a 2D ultrasound about halfway through your pregnancy (between 18 and 22 weeks). What ultrasounds will I have during pregnancy? In a 4D ultrasound, a series of 3D images is put together to form a low-resolution video. 4D ultrasound adds a fourth dimension – time.3D ultrasound uses the same basic idea as 2D ultrasound, but takes many images from different angles and processes them together to create an image that looks like a real photograph.This process creates simple, black-and-white images that create a cross-section view, with bright spots for denser materials like bone. 2D ultrasound is the standard ultrasound that healthcare providers use.The waves bounce off tissues to create a picture on a screen. The ultrasound machines used for medical imaging use waves between 2 to 20 megahertz – that's about 100 times higher than the top of the range we're able to hear (20 to 20,000 hertz). It works just like the sonar on boats, which use sound waves to locate things underwater. Ultrasound is a way to look inside the body with high-frequency sound waves. ![]()
